			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>First it was the hundreds of gators that had allegedly collected in a waterway in Butte La Rose. Then, it was the INSANELY huge 'Morganza Snake' that had slithered out of hiding to strike fear into the hearts of Acadiana Facebook users. Well, it turns out that <a href="http://www.liveleak.com/view?i=242_1279955525" target="_blank">video of the gators</a> was actually from a rare feeding frenzy caught on tape a year ago in Georgia, and the <a href="http://1079ishot.com/insanely-huge-snake-spotted-near-morganza-real-or-fake-photo/" target="_blank">'Morganza Snake'</a> was really a King Brown snake, the second longest species of snake in Australia, <a href="http://hypervocal.com/news/2011/so-the-20-foot-long-morganza-snake-photo-is-real-but-the-story-is-not/" target="_blank">where the picture was actually taken.</a></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>BATON ROUGE (May 13, 2011) - Louisiana officials advise citizens to expect road closings and other impacts when the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ers opens the Morganza Spillway during the next 24 hours. The state will begin closing impacted roads and restrict public access to some levees in order to protect the public from dangerous conditions.  When the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ers opens the Morganza Spillway</p>
